Sign UpTournaments and victories
- The StarCraft II tournament IGN ProLeague Season 4 finished on April 8, 2012, and aLive became its winner, who was representing Fnatic at that moment. He beat Squirtle in the grand final with a score 3:2 and 3:0, which guaranteed him $40,000 of grabs.
- The championship The Gathering 2012 came to the end on April 8, 2012, however, its prize pool amounted only $17,000. LucifroN made a triumph in the competition, having overcome Brat_OK in the final match with a score 4:1.
- On April 8, 2017, the team Lunatic-Hai won Overwatch APEX Season 2, having earned $90,000. The guys beat RunAways in the grand final with a score 4:3.
